POST-TRUMP DIPLOMACY OUTLOOK

E. de Lima Figueiredo, E. Migon, P. Visentini, C. Pecequilo, J. Martins, A. da Silva, R. Rianhez, G. Thudium, L. Geiger, E. Ribeiro,
2021

The electoral defeat of Republican candidate Donald Trump and the return to power of the Democrats with Joseph Biden cannot be left unexamined, considering its implications for international relations. Here we present notes from NERINT Strategic Analysis , written by experts and divided into thematic issues and bilateral relations between the United States and the most relevant nations at the global level.
